NBA Draft Swain is better than Carr 🤷🏾‍♂️

I don't think a lot of Chicago fans looked at Dailyn Swain as soon as Carr became visible in the combine (including me) and the rumors of him fitting at 15 started happening, but I wouldn't call Swain a drop off.

He's taller, has a more NBA-ready body, is a better rebounder, plays better defense, had more assists, a better true shooting percentage, and has the same eFG% as Carr. He drives more, and I get that you heard Jay Bilas say he's not much of a 3pt shooter, but Carr only shot a couple percentage points better from beyond the stripe. That's not a huge gap, and Swain got better, year-over-year from 2 and 3, with more attempts, while Carr dipped in both categories as his attempts rose.

I think the Bulls simply saw a guy who fit their intended scheme and culture better.
